3G Mens Tour Black Right Hand

3G Bowling brings you the classic, Tour Black, performance shoe. This shoe combines timeless style, improved comfort, and premium features including a 50% larger EVA wedge that gradually increases towards the heel for improved positioning during the slide. The uuthentic Buckskin slide frame provides consistency and durability, as well as improved rubber quality on the traction foot and shoe parts and interchangeable slide sole and heels.

  • Right Hand
  • Color: Black
  • Material: Full grain leather (sustainable Comfort leather)
  • Interchangeable sole and heel
  • Kevlar rubber traction sole
  • Replaceable DuPont Kevlar toe cap
  • Vented inner soles
  • *Size conversion – Mens 4.5 = Women size 6.5
  • Included on slide foot shoe: Sole Deer Skin and Heel Flat Normal
  • No extra parts included
  • Additional soles & heels sold separately

Question:


What does right hand mean? Does it mean the sole of the right shoe is different from the left one?

11/5/2022 - By

Have an answer to this question?

Answer:


If a shoe specifies "right handed" then the shoe will have the slide sole on the left shoe and a traction sole on the right shoe.
